Access the power of automation and tag your orders based on simple or complex workflows of your choosing.

Applying tags can help you filter orders based on a particular set of criteria. For example, you might want to filter orders in your Shopify Admin area that have been placed with a specific delivery method so that you can fulfil them quickly, or, you might like to identify orders placed by first-time customers so that a welcome gift can be placed in their order.

Tagging orders is a vital step in building automation workflows for the processing and fulfilment of orders.

Key Features:

  • Using Order Taggers multi-condition workflow builder to apply Shopify order tags
  • Order Tagger can automatically tag orders based on a wide variety of conditions.
  • Order Tagger workflows can be triggered at different stages of the fulfilment process
  • Most order data can be used as the criteria for creating workflows.
  • The workflow builder allows you to select multiple criteria and conditions to create highly segmented workflows to target and tag specific orders.
  • Order Tagger provides you with the ability to apply fixed tags when the order matches your workflow. These are tag names that you define in the workflow.
  • Dynamic tags are based on the value of certain attributes within an order, such as SKU codes, payment methods used, line item values, order note values or UTM tags values and much more!
  • Plus Merchants can utilise our Flow Connector to trigger creative workflows. Order Tagger will send a trigger into Shopify Flow once it has processed a new order. The Flow can check for a condition e.g. a certain tag exists on the order - and if the condition is met, take an action like sending an email to your admin team or forwarding the order to a logistics partner via http.
